Amendment of the Social Security (Work-focused Interviews) Regulations 2000

3.  In regulation 5 of the Social Security (Work-focused Interviews) Regulations 2000 M1 (exemptions)—

(a)in paragraph (1), at the beginning of both sub-paragraphs (b) and (c), there shall be inserted the words “ except in a case to which paragraph (1A) applies, ”;

(b)after paragraph (1) there shall be inserted the following paragraph—

(1A) Notwithstanding paragraph (1)(b) and (c), a claim for a specified benefit shall give rise to an interview under regulation 4 where—

(a)at the time the claim is made, the person making the claim is a member of a joint-claim couple as defined for the purposes of the Jobseeker’s Allowance Regulations 1996 M2; and

(b)it has been decided that that person is a person to whom a paragraph of Schedule A1 to those Regulations applies (categories of members of joint-claim couples who are not required to satisfy the conditions in section 1(2B)(b) of the Jobseekers Act 1995)..
